About the Role

Position: Childcare Apprentice

As an Apprentice Educator you will work within the nursery team, support the learning and development of children, and study towards a Level 3 Childcare qualification.

Responsibilities

  • Work within the ethos of the nursery, providing a warm, welcoming and stimulating environment.
  • Support senior and qualified practitioners to ensure well‑being, care and learning of all children, including those with additional needs.
  • Assist with planning and preparation of activities tailored to children’s individual needs.
  • Communicate with parents and negotiate working targets to maintain effective communication within the nursery.
  • Provide learning experiences that challenge and support children’s confidence and independence.
  • Nurture positive relationships and role‑model positive behaviour, promoting emotional well‑being, confidence and self‑esteem.
  • Record observations, assessments, monitoring and keep learning and development records to inform planning.
  • Supervise meals and mealtimes, and prepare food/bottles for babies as appropriate.
  • Adhere at all times to Allergies & Allergic Reactions Policy and Sleep Policy.
  • Promote inclusion and equality policies and procedures.
  • Work as a reliable, co‑operative team member with flexibility.
  • Work flexible hours as requested by the manager.
  • Carry out any other duties appropriate to the post as directed by the Nursery Manager and The Company Directors.

  • Training Outcome

Progression towards a Level3 Childcare (Early Years Educator) qualification through the REALISE LEARNING AND EMPLOYMENT LIMITED apprenticeship programme.

Working Arrangements

Working Week: 40 hours a week, Monday to Friday, shifts to be confirmed. Expected duration: 1 year 2 months.
